Katie Martin and Rob Armstrong discuss the future of the Federal Reserve following Jay Powell's remarks and the potential leadership of Kevin Warsh.
Yesterday, JayPowell made his final remarks as chair of the Federal Reserve. And then he announced his intention to remain on the board. Today on the show, Katie Martin and Rob Armstrong think about the future of the Fed under likely successor Kevin Warsh, who will govern with a former chair on the board.
